Since the laser light must be absorbed by the pigment particles, the laser wavelength must be selected to match the absorption spectrum of the pigment. Q-Switched 1064 nm lasers are best suited for treating dark blue and black tattoos, but Q-Switched 532nm lasers are best suitable for treating red and orange tattoos.
The amount of energy (fluence/joules/jcm2) is determined prior to each treatment as well as the spot size and treatment speed (Hz/hertz).
During the treatment process, the laser beam passes harmlessly through the skin, targeting only the ink resting in a liquid state within. While it is possible to see immediate results, in most cases the fading occurs gradually over the 7–8 week healing period between treatments. In the days and weeks following a laser treatment, the body’s immune system flushes away the shattered ink particles, causing the tattoo to fade. Over a series of treatments, more and more of the ink shatters, leaving the skin free of ink.

How Laser Tattoo Removal Works?
The Q-Switched Nd: YAG laser delivers light of specific wavelengths in very high peak energy pulses which are absorbed by the pigment in the tattoo and result in an acoustic shockwave. The shockwave shatters the pigment particles, releasing them from their encapsulation and breaking them into fragments small enough for removal by the body. These tiny particles are then eliminated by the body.
